Background
Artificial intelligence has been gradually making inroads into sports, with technology firms and football clubs investing significantly in AI-driven scouting, injury prevention, and fan engagement tools. Innovations such as predictive analytics, computer vision, and natural language processing are changing how football data is collected and interpreted.
Until recently, AI in football was mostly confined to isolated experiments or back-end analytics. The Maidenhead United vs Wolves match marks a shift to real-time, integrated AI applications that influence live decision-making and audience experience during a competitive fixture. This development is the result of years of advancements in AI algorithms, improved sensor technology, and increased computing power.
